Used APV N35 Plate pasteurizer 10246 KghTechnical Specifications &
Performance DataThis plate pasteurizer is engineered for continuous
high-efficiency thermal treatment in beverage and dairy processing.
Manufactured by APV Products, the N35 model provides reliable heat
exchange performance with a compact footprint, making it ideal for
integration into a used bottling line or broader industrial packaging
and beverage production setup.Manufacturer: APV ProductsModel:
N35Nominal capacity: 10,246 kg/hHeat transfer surface: 54.6 m²Working
pressure: 10 barWorking temperature range: 0.9 to 100 °COverall
width: 1300 mmOverall height (max): 2500 mmOverall length: 2700 mm
(approx. 3000 mm with control cabinet)Configuration: Plate heat
exchanger pasteurizer (HTST/flash process)Previous application: Milk
processingAdvanced Automation & Control SystemsThe APV N35 plate
pasteurizer supports modern automation architectures for precise
thermal treatment. Typical configurations include PID control of
product and heating media with temperature, flow, and pressure
instrumentation, as well as interlocks for safe operation. Integration
with a plant PLC/HMI enables recipe management, trend logging, and
alarm handling to stabilize outlet temperature and holding-time
compliance. Operator safeguards and clear access points facilitate
routine checks and adjustments while maintaining hygienic conditions.
Quick disconnects and service-friendly plate pack design help minimize
downtime during maintenance or format changes.Production Line

profiles.Installation Requirements & Site PreparationPlan installation
with the stated dimensions and allow service clearance for plate pack
tightening, CIP connections, and instrumentation access. Utilities
typically include steam or hot water for heating (via heat exchanger
service circuit), chilled water or glycol for regeneration/cooling
stages if used, and plant electricity for controls and pumps. Provide
suitable foundations for static stability and hygienic drainage, along
with sanitary piping connections and valves matched to site
standards.Safety Standards & Compliance CertificationHygienic
